How reports The Times, British Prime Minister Rishi Sunak discussed with Egyptian President Al-Sisi a possible strike on Houthi positions in the Red Sea.
As the publication clarifies, negotiations on this issue were necessary, since any attack from the British Akrotiri base in Cyprus would cross Egyptian airspace.
Earlier on Thursday, Sunak informed his cabinet that a military strike against the Houthis was imminent, The Times said.
“The UK will join the US in carrying out airstrikes against Houthi positions in Yemen on the night of December 11-12,” the article says.
